Industry current state

• Industrial IoT != Consumer IoT• Sensors already exist

• Connectivity only within closed ecosystems

• Not IP based

• Mature market

• Existing technology concept suitable for small scaled systems

• Current state of TMS applied in tunnels

Challenges in Industrial IoT

• BS Husky platform focuses on:• Agregating industrial and

manufacturer protocols

• Allowing communication between devices that commonly do not „talk“

• Vendor independency

• Defining set of rules based on large-scale data

• Demanding challenge: new sets of controlling rules

• Industrial IoT challenges:• Lack of interoperability standards

• Legacy of existing equipment (eg. no connectivity or embedded sensors)

• Techonology immaturity (eg. Large-scale analytics)

• Programming technologies

• Security

• ...

Video Camera Incident Detection

• Incident detection scenarios:• Red light violation• Wrong direction• Wrong turn• U-turn• Solid line crossing• Stopped vehicle• Unique identification of vehicles• Pedestrian on road• Object on road• ....

• Advantages:• Camera as a widely spread sensor• Minimal use of its potential• Easy to install • Easy to use• Easy to integrate• Installation on existing

infrastructure • Multifunctional application
